Output fec59f203e669494c9c6bcb44d2ebc8f8b363e4abccc15e5bbb27edbb0f73b73:1

value
28729732
script pubkey
OP_0 OP_PUSHBYTES_20 38f8401c8fa9d17d4c614b2f9c071f1da536d1df
address
bc1q8ruyq8y048gh6nrpfvhecpclrkjnd5wlqu7xvq
transaction
fec59f203e669494c9c6bcb44d2ebc8f8b363e4abccc15e5bbb27edbb0f73b73
confirmations
119265
spent
true